Postgrad Research Showcase (LGBTQ+ History)

Thursday 27 June 2024, 5pm - 7pm

Blomeley Rooms, Students' Union Hub
About this event

Following on from LGBTQ+ History Month in February, we're hosting talks showcasing some of the fascinating areas of lesbian, gay, bisexual, trans and queer history that our postgraduates are currently researching. This summer, we have two very exciting talks from:

Charlotte Byrne (English and Drama)– (Re)constructing Anarchist Lesbian Identities of 1930s Spain in Fiction 

Kieran Stigant (History)– Reframing Gay Activism in 1960s America: the Transition to a Movement for Emotional Liberty
